The books of The Bible that are classified as poetry, such as Psalms, Proverbs, and Song of Solomon, are called so because they are written in poetic forms like parallelism, imagery, and meter. These books often use metaphorical language, symbolism, and figurative expressions to convey spiritual truths, emotions, and wisdom.

The 5 books of poetry from the Bible come from the Old Testament. They are Job, Psalms, Proverbs, Ecclesiastes, and The Song of Solomon.
